Mutated neo-antigens as targets for individualized cancer immunotherapy

Carcinogenesis is largely driven by somatic gene mutations. Accumulating evidence suggests that a significant subset of mutations result in neo-epitopes recognized by tumor- specific T cells and thus may constitute the Achilles' heel of malignant cells. T cells directed …
